Webb15 juli 2024 · MONITORING HEAD GROWTH Occipitofrontal circumference (OFC) should be measured at health maintenance visits between birth and three years of age and in any child with neurologic symptoms or developmental complaints. The technique for measuring head circumference ( picture 1) is discussed separately. WebbA head circumference below the 5(th) centile at second-trimester scan is associated with various abnormalities, especially neurological disorders. The outcome was worse when the HC was smaller. An HC Z score below -2.5 was strongly associated with neurological and chromosomal abnormalities.
Webb16 feb. 2024 · Microcephaly is a neonatal malformation defined as a head size much smaller compared with other babies of the same age and sex. If this combines with poor brain growth, babies with microcephaly can develop developmental disabilities. The severity of microcephaly ranges from mild to severe.
Webb5 apr. 2024 · The average newborn head circumference is about 13.5 inches. Your baby's doctor will measure and chart your baby's head circumference from birth through 2 years of age.
